AEON operates the Hao Chinese Academy, which focuses on providing high-quality Chinese language instruction through various learning modalities, including online courses.
"Super Chinese" is a comprehensive e-learning resource designed to reinforce foundational Chinese language skills. This program is not only accessible to students enrolled at the Hao Chinese Academy but is also utilized as supplemental learning material by several universities across Japan. The course encompasses a cyclical learning method consisting of video lessons, drill practice, and evaluative tests, enabling participants to build their vocabulary and grammar skills from beginner to intermediate levels. Importantly, the curriculum supports not only everyday conversation but also preparation for the HSK (Hanyu Shuiping Kaoshi) levels 4 and 5, along with business dialogue training.
A distinctive feature of the program is the "My Portfolio" functionality. This innovative tool visualizes individual learning progress and achievements in graphical format, enhancing motivation and allowing for effective tracking of one's advancement through the course materials.

About Hao Chinese Academy
Founded in 2004, Hao Chinese Academy has made it its mission to provide high-quality Chinese lesson and sincere service in language learning, contributing to the development of Chinese education in Japan. With diverse learning styles adapting to the current era, including e-learning, online lessons, and in-person classes, the academy has enriched the content of Chinese learning, covering beginner Chinese, business Chinese, HSK exam preparation, and professional interpreter training. The academy will continue pursuing reforms to enhance Chinese education in Japan.
